Officials Investigating What Sparked Mott Street Fire

January 28, 2013 2:24pm | Updated January 28, 2013 2:24pm
View Full Caption

CHINATOWN — Officials are investigating the cause of a Mott Street fire that gutted a three-story apartment building Sunday.

The blaze at 75 Mott St. near Canal Street started just before 3:30 p.m. and was brought under control about an hour later, officials said.

Three firefighters were taken to a local hospital and treated for smoke inhalation.

“I’m very disappointed. I don’t understand why [it started],” said a 60-year-old man who identified himself as the building’s manager. “I’m just trying to find out what happened.”
